如何在Pyspark数据框中创建新的列,每行的增量为X分钟。
exampleDF.withColumn("time",current_timestamp() + expr("INTERVAL 5 MINUTES"))
上面创建的新列时间在整个列中具有相同的值,我需要每行增加X分钟。
如果当前日期时间为 2019-03-16T16:05:18.219 + 0000 并且期望 具有1分钟增量行的列。
预期输出:-
2019-03-16T16:05:19.219+0000
2019-03-16T16:05:20.219+0000
2019-03-16T16:05:21.219+0000
2019-03-16T16:05:22.219+0000
2019-03-16T16:05:23.219+0000
2019-03-16T16:05:24.219+0000
2019-03-16T16:05:25.219+0000